More of the Same

Good morning! Oliver's platelets and crit are both in the 20's so he won't be needing any transfusions today. His potassium levels have been elevated for the last couple of days, which can be hard on your heart. Yesterday Oliver's heart rate was dipping into the high 80's and low 90's so last night they did an EKG. I'd be lying if I said this didn't have me a little worried. I know they were planning on repeating the EKG soon anyway, but they don't usually do these kind of tests at night unless they are very concerned. I don't know what the results of the EKG were, but I know they are giving him more lasix (not for it's intended purpose, as a diuretic, but for it's side effect of depleting your potassium). He was pretty unhappy last night unless he was being held. I felt so helpless 3 blocks away and unable to go comfort him. Thankfully the nurses all took turns holding him and shortly after midnight he was out like a light and slept until morning.

We are anxiously awaiting those test results from Cincinnati...should be here by the end of next week. So many things are hinging on those results. Will Oliver need a bone marrow transplant? How much longer will we be here in Seattle? If Oliver needs a bone marrow transplant we will probably have to leave the home we love so much. Not only would we need to stay in Seattle for 6-8 more months, but when we are able to go home Oliver would have to stay away from things like freshly turned soil and livestock. Both of which are right out our back door.

For now we just focus on what's ahead of us today. We focus on Oliver, and keep giving him reasons to smile...because that brings joy to all of us. :)
